New footage of the savage assault on a disabled woman in a Manhattan subway station captures the hulking brute claiming he was trying to help the victim “with your f–king walker” during the beating.
The lengthy cellphone video – taken by a transit worker and obtained by The Post Wednesday – allegedly shows Norton Blake, 43, beating 60-year-old Laurell Reynolds with a cane, a belt and then his fists inside the West 116 Street and Lenox Avenue subway station early Friday.
After he’s done hitting, smacking, punching and kicking the defenseless woman, the suspect yells at his cowering victim that he was “trying to be a brother” to her, the nearly three-and-a-half minute-long clip shows.
